When considering which edge rusher the Detroit Lions might make a deal for before the trade deadline (if they make a deal), the list is long and stretches from unrealistic pipe dreams to very realistic possibilities.

Head coach Dan Campbell hinted at the search for an edge rusher going to a different level this week when he acknowledged general manager Brad Holmes had him take a closer look at “a couple things.”

Until something is done or 4 p.m. ET on Nov. 5 (trade deadline day) has passed, there will be plenty of speculation about who the Lions might add to replace Aidan Hutchinson. When previously unmentioned names come up, it can be worth noting.
